Section 1: Emerging Trends in Geospatial Analysis

The field of geospatial analysis is rapidly evolving, with new trends and technologies emerging every year. One of the most significant trends is the increasing use of artificial intelligence (AI) and machine learning (ML) in geospatial analysis. These technologies enable investigators to analyze vast amounts of data quickly and accurately, identifying patterns and connections that may have gone unnoticed through traditional methods. The Professional Certificate in Geospatial Analysis covers the application of AI and ML in geospatial analysis, providing learners with hands-on experience in using these technologies to enhance their investigative skills. Another emerging trend is the integration of geospatial analysis with other disciplines, such as criminology and sociology, to provide a more comprehensive understanding of complex issues.

Section 2: Innovations in Geospatial Technology

Recent innovations in geospatial technology have revolutionized the field of investigative analysis. The development of unmanned aerial vehicles (UAVs) and satellite imaging has enabled investigators to collect high-resolution data from remote or hard-to-reach areas. The Professional Certificate in Geospatial Analysis covers the use of UAVs and satellite imaging in geospatial analysis, providing learners with the skills to collect, analyze, and interpret this data. Another significant innovation is the development of geospatial analytics software, such as ArcGIS and QGIS, which provide investigators with powerful tools to analyze and visualize geospatial data. The program also covers the application of these software tools, enabling learners to create interactive maps, 3D models, and other visualizations to communicate their findings effectively.

Section 3: Future Developments in Geospatial Analysis

As geospatial analysis continues to evolve, we can expect to see significant future developments in this field. One of the most exciting areas of development is the integration of geospatial analysis with the Internet of Things (IoT). The increasing use of IoT devices, such as sensors and cameras, will provide investigators with a vast amount of real-time data to analyze and interpret. The Professional Certificate in Geospatial Analysis will cover the application of IoT data in geospatial analysis, enabling learners to stay ahead of the curve in this rapidly evolving field. Another area of development is the use of geospatial analysis in predictive policing, where investigators can use data analytics and machine learning to predict and prevent crimes.
